Key Ingredients for Sausage and Lentil Soup
Sausage and lentil soup is a heartwarming dish that comforts on chilly evenings and packs a nutritious punch. Each ingredient plays a vital role in crafting this cozy meal, elevating flavors and textures beyond the ordinary.
Sausage
The star of the dish, Italian sausage—either sweet or spicy—infuses the soup with bold flavor. I recommend using fresh sausage links removed from their casings for the best results. Browning the sausage releases its natural oils and spices, ensuring each spoonful is full of hearty goodness.
Lentils
For this recipe, green or brown lentils are perfect due to their firm texture. Unlike red lentils, which can turn mushy, these hold their shape, providing a lovely bite in every serving.
Vegetables
A classic mirepoix blend of onions, carrots, and celery lays the flavor foundation. These aromatic veggies create a sweet-savory base that enhances the entire dish. Don’t forget to include garlic for an extra layer of depth.
Broth
Using low-sodium chicken or vegetable broth allows you to control the saltiness while adding moisture and richness to the soup.
Herbs and Spices
Fresh thyme and bay leaves infuse a fragrant aroma, while pepper gives a hint of heat. These subtle additions elevate the overall flavor profile, making every bowl a delight.

Variations on Sausage and Lentil Soup
Savoring Sausage and Lentil Soup is not just a culinary experience; it’s a delightful journey through flavors that can be customized to fit your mood or pantry status. The beauty of this comforting dish lies in its versatility, allowing you to experiment with different ingredients while maintaining its beloved character.
Add Some Greens
For an added boost of nutrition, consider tossing in some fresh kale or spinach. These leafy greens not only enhance the soup’s color but also provide a plethora of vitamins. Cooking them in the soup for the last few minutes ensures they maintain their vibrant texture and nutrients.
Spice It Up
Feeling adventurous? Cumin or smoked paprika can add a warm, earthy flavor to your Sausage and Lentil Soup. Just a teaspoon can elevate the dish and give it an exciting twist, perfect for those chilly evenings when you crave something robust.
Swap the Sausage
While traditional pork or Italian sausages are delicious, try using chicken or turkey sausage for a lighter version. Vegetarian sausage is also a fantastic option, offering the same hearty flavor without meat.
Experiment with Lentils
While brown or green lentils work well, don’t hesitate to explore red or yellow lentils. These varieties cook faster and provide a different texture, making your soup even more dynamic.

Cooking Tips and Notes for Sausage and Lentil Soup
Creating a delicious Sausage and Lentil Soup is about blending flavors and textures. This hearty dish warms the soul and sparks joy on chilly evenings. Here are some tips and notes to help you on this culinary journey.
Choose the Right Sausage
When selecting sausage, opt for high-quality links with a blend of herbs and spices. Whether you prefer spicy Italian or a milder chicken sausage, the quality will deeply influence your soup’s flavor. If you’re feeling adventurous, try experimenting with smoked sausage for an added depth.
Lentils Matter
For this Sausage and Lentil Soup, I recommend green or brown lentils. They hold their shape well compared to red lentils, which tend to break down. Rinse the lentils under cold water before adding them to your pot to remove any residual dirt.
Don’t Skip the Aromatics
Aromatic vegetables like onions, garlic, and carrots are the foundation for your soup. Sauté them until they’re tender and fragrant before adding the lentils and broth. This step enhances the overall flavor and sets the stage for a delicious finish.
Simmer for Full Flavor
Once everything is in the pot, let your soup simmer gently. The longer it cooks, the more the flavors meld together. This is a perfect opportunity to multitask, allowing it to simmer while you tackle other tasks around the house.
Taste and Adjust
Before serving, take a moment to taste your soup. You might find it needs a pinch more salt or a splash of vinegar to brighten the flavors. Small adjustments can elevate your Sausage and Lentil Soup from good to unforgettable.

Sausage and Lentil Soup
- Total Time: 100 minutes
- Yield: 6 servings 1x
Description
A hearty soup packed with flavors from Italian sausage, brown lentils, and roasted red peppers.
Ingredients
- 1 package (19 oz.) Italian Sausage (see notes)
- 2 tsp. olive oil (or more, depending on your pan)
- 1 onion, diced into small pieces
- 1 cup brown lentils
- 6 cups chicken broth (see notes)
- 2 tsp. ground fennel (do not leave out)
- 1 tsp. dried thyme
- 1 tsp. rubbed sage (dried)
- 1 12 oz. jar roasted red peppers
Instructions
- Heat olive oil in a heavy frying pan, add Italian sausage and brown well, breaking sausage into pieces as it cooks.
- Add sausage to soup pot.
- In the same pan, adding more oil if needed, brown onions until softened and barely starting to brown.
- Add onions to soup pot.
- Rinse out the pan with 1 cup chicken broth, then add to soup pot along with the rest of broth, lentils, ground fennel, thyme, and sage.
- Cook at the lowest possible simmer for about 45 minutes, until lentils are softened but still holding their shape.
- Drain the roasted red peppers while the soup simmers, then chop into pieces about 1/2 inch square.
- Add red peppers to soup and cook about 45 minutes more (adding a little more broth or water if needed), until some lentils are starting to fall apart and all flavors are well blended.
- Season Sausage and Lentil Soup with salt and fresh ground black pepper and serve hot.
Notes
- For a spicier flavor, consider using hot Italian sausage.
- It’s important to brown the sausage well for the best flavor.
- Adjust the broth quantity based on desired soup consistency.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 90 minutes
- Category: Soup
- Method: Stovetop
- Cuisine: Italian
